Urbánica has announced that it is planning to start building the first of three 14-storey buildings and 112 apartments in Antiguo Cuscatlán at the end of this year.
The developer plans to start building the first of the towers later this year, and construction of a second and third will depend on the sales process.According to Alejandro Duenas, executive director of Urbánica, in the first phase of construction $24 million will be invested.
Urbánica announced the construction this year of a 130-room Marriott Fairfield hotel in downtown La Gran Vía, and plans to start operations in 2017.
The real estate developer announced the construction of the Urbánica Marriott Fairfield hotel, located in the shopping center La Gran Vía in San Salvador, for an investment of approximately $17 million. The property will focus on the business tourism segment as does the Marriott Courtyard, developed in the same area.
The project Puerta La Palma, developed by the Real Estate division Dueñas Hermanos Ltda., will feature 66 homes, with a construction area of between 265 square meters and 283 square meters.
The project, targeting high income families, will be located in what the developers call "District El Espino", which ecompasses the area from Gran Via shopping center down to La Castellana, Portal Ribera, the residential site El Espino and Portal Canarias.
Portal del Casco is a new residential project by Urbánica, the real estate division of Dueñas Hermanos Ltda.
The project will comprise 92 lots over 30 squares, in a nature friendly environment. 60 lots will be up for sale in the first phase.
“$25.3 million will be invested in the project: $10 million in infrastructure costs, and the rest in land value. They will build ‘town house’ residences”, reported Laprensagrafica.com.
